Twelfth Station: Jesus dies on the cross
We adore you, O Christ, and we bless you
because by your holy cross you have redeemed the world.
Bible Reading – Luke 23. 44-46
It was about twelve o’clock when the sun stopped shining and darkness covered the whole country until three o’clock. And the curtain hanging in the Temple was torn in two. Jesus cried out in a loud voice, ‘Father in your hands I place my spirit.’ He said this and died.
Meditation
In your hands he placed himself:
all that he was,
all that he had ever been,
all his beauty,
all his obedience,
all his loving.
In God’s hands he placed himself.
He was returning to his father,
he was going home.
Prayer
For all who have died today;
for those who love them and will miss them:
Lord, in your mercy
hear our prayer.
